Per diem method vs multiplier method

Two methods can be utilized by injury lawyers to calculate the amount of pain and suffering damages. They are the per diem method and the multiplier method. The methods are different and will differ based on the specific situation.

The per diem method imposes a certain amount of money for each day that the victim is suffering. The multiplier method functions in the same manner as the per diem method but instead of taking into account the pain and suffering damages it determines the economic damages. This includes lost wages medical expenses, travel costs to doctors, and all other expenses.

Both methods have their merits They aren't the only way to calculate damages. A jury will consider both methods and determine the worth of the claim depending on the degree of the injuries. It is usually more difficult for suffering and pain to be quantified, particularly when it's a major injury.

A person who has been injured may require continuous psychological treatment and therapy. The multiplier technique may be required depending on the degree of the injury. In some cases, a more severe injury will require more of a multiplier.

An attorney typically bases the pain and suffering award on the per-diem method. However when the injury is permanent, the per-diem method may not be suitable.

The multiplier method evaluates the economic impact and the impact that the injury will have on the lives of the victims. Economic damages may include medical bills and out-of-pocket costs for over-the-counter medications, loss of wages, and other costs. Other expenses can also be included in economic damages.

Wrongful death

You may be able to file a wrongful-death claim if you have lost a loved one due of negligence by someone else's. Your family could be eligible to seek comp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and funeral expenses. However, you must hire an experienced attorney to ensure that you get the most appropriate compensation.

Numerous types of personal injury can result in wrongful deaths such as car accidents and medical negligence. A lawyer who specializes in wrongful death can help you understand your rights and guide you through the legal procedure.

In general, a wrongful deaths lawsuit involves filing a complaint against several defendants. The plaintiff, or the representative of the deceased, will need to prove that the defendants were responsible for the accident. The lawsuit will be brought to trial based on facts.

In order to establish the liability, you'll have to gather evidence, such as eyewitness testimony and surveillance videos of nearby establishments. The jury will examine the circumstances and assign a percentage of fault to the person who caused the incident.

In a wrongful death case, you will also need to establish that the defendant acted in a way that was unreasonable under the circumstances. This can include speeding and failure to use reasonable safety precautions.

You may also have to prove that the remaining family members suffered financial losses. These could include lost wages med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ering.
